Ricoh India and TCIL to supply rural ICT solution for department of posts
TT Correspondent |  |  26 Nov 2014

Ricoh India, on Tuesday announced that they have been chosen by Department of Posts, along with Telecommunications Consultants India (TCIL), as the System Integrator for “Rural Information & Communication Technology (ICT) – Hardware (RH)” Solution, which will enable them to modernize approximately 129,000 Post Offices through automation.
 
Under the Ministry of Communications & IT, the Rural ICT Project is a part of the larger IT modernization project being undertaken by the Department of Posts. The primary goal of the Rural ICT project is to improve the quality of service, provide more value added services and achieve “financial inclusion” of un-banked rural population. This will provide wider reach to Indian populace through more customer interaction channels.

Department of Posts has selected Ricoh India Ltd for supply, installation and maintenance services of hardware, peripheral devices and operating system for “Rural Information & Communication Technology (ICT) – Hardware (RH)”  Solution. The scope of work includes supply of mobile computing devices and peripherals, installation of solar UPS, connectivity to access the application by service providers along with maintenance for five years.
